* Add functionality to SerializationContext and @AutoCodec to check that a ↵Gravatar janakr2018-06-05
| | | | | | | | class is allowed to be serialized in the current context. A codec can now add an explicitly allowed class that can be serialized underneath it (via SerializationContext#addExplicitlyAllowedClass), and that class's codec can check that it is explicitly allowed (via SerializationContext#checkClassExplicitlyAllowed). It is a runtime crash if a codec checks that it was explicitly allowed and finds that it wasn't. Thus, if PackageCodec is invoked without it having been explicitly allowed, we will crash, preventing Package from sneaking into a value it shouldn't be in. This is only enabled if the codec is memoizing. PiperOrigin-RevId: 199317936

* Replace all usages of Blaze's Preconditions class with guava.Gravatar tomlu2017-11-09
| | | | | | | | Blaze had its own class to avoid GC from varargs array creation for the precondition happy path. Guava now (mostly) implements these, making it unnecessary to maintain our own. This change was almost entirely automated by search-and-replace. A few BUILD files needed fixing up since I removed an export of preconditions from lib:util, which was all done by add_deps. There was one incorrect usage of Preconditions that was caught by error prone (which checks Guava's version of Preconditions) that I had to change manually. PiperOrigin-RevId: 175033526
* Refactor ConfiguredAttributeMapper to lib/packages from lib/analysis.Gravatar cparsons2017-10-11
| | | | | | | | | This requires moving the convenience constructor using RuleConfiguredTarget to be owned by RuleConfiguredTarget. This refactoring is required by later work to allow SplitTransitionProvider to use configurable attributes. This would require packages/Attribute.java -> analysis/ConfiguredAttributeMapper.java, where in general, the 'analysis' package depends on the 'packages' package. This is the easiest way to prevent a circular dependency. RELNOTES: None. PiperOrigin-RevId: 171741620
